Decoding the Phase O Matic Wiring Diagram

A Phase O Matic wiring diagram is essentially a schematic that illustrates the electrical connections within a Phase O Matic system. It shows the layout of various components such as motors, relays, switches, transformers, and control circuits. Think of it as the electrical nervous system of the machine. Technicians, electricians, and even informed operators rely heavily on these diagrams to understand the flow of electricity and how different parts interact. Without a proper Phase O Matic wiring diagram, identifying and resolving electrical issues would be a time-consuming and often guesswork-filled process. The importance of having an accurate and legible Phase O Matic wiring diagram cannot be overstated for effective maintenance and repair.

The primary use of a Phase O Matic wiring diagram is for troubleshooting. When a machine malfunctions, the diagram allows for a systematic approach to pinpointing the problem. For example, it can help identify if a particular switch is faulty, if a wire has become disconnected, or if a relay is not engaging as it should. Beyond repairs, these diagrams are also invaluable during the installation or modification of Phase O Matic equipment. They ensure that all connections are made correctly, preventing potential hazards and ensuring optimal performance. Here's a glimpse into what you might find within:

  • Component Symbols: Standardized symbols represent different electrical parts.
  • Wire Identifiers: Numbers or letters that trace individual wires through the system.
  • Connection Points: Clearly marked points where wires connect to components.

Furthermore, the Phase O Matic wiring diagram can be used for educational purposes, helping individuals learn about electrical systems and the specific design of Phase O Matic products. It’s a powerful tool for understanding:

  1. How power is supplied to different circuits.
  2. The sequence of operations for various functions.
  3. Safety interlocks and their connections.
